FCC Information Quality Guidelines

The FCC is dedicated to ensuring that all data it disseminates reflect a level of quality commensurate with the nature and timeliness of the information. Futher, the FCC seeks to disseminate all its data as broadly and promptly as possible so that the public can benefit from the FCC's work of ensuring vital and innovative communication services are available to all Americans at reasonable prices. In keeping with this commitment, and in accordance with OMB requirements, the FCC follows the guidelines noted below for the development and dissmenination of agency information. These guidelines and the associated Data Quality comment form relate only to information released directly by the FCC. If you have a concern about the activities and practices of the industries that the FCC regulates, please send your comment to fccinfo@fcc.gov.

Filing Complaints or Appeals

Parties interested in filing a complaint about an information dissemination product disseminated by the FCC, or appealing the resolution of a complaint about an information dissemination prodcut covered by the FCC's Information Quality Guidelines should first read Appendix A, Section 4 of the guidelines (pages 9-10).

Please DO NOT use this form if your concern or complaint is about activities of the industries regulated by the FCC. Typical of these type of concerns are obscenity or indecency during a radio or television broadcast, billing or telephone service issues, or violations of do-not-call or do-not-fax rules. Concerns with the activities of the industries that the FCC regulates are consumer complaints which are addressed on our File a Complaint web page.

Those who have a concern about an information product directly disseminated by the FCC can file a complaint by providing the information identified at http://www.fcc.gov/omd/dataquality/complaint. This information can be submitted electronically by clicking on the link found on the complaint page (http://www.fcc.gov/omd/dataquality/complaint) or by mailing the information to the Federal Communications Commission, 445 12th Street, SW, Data Quality Comments, Room 1-B115, Washington, DC 20554.
